Understanding Marketing Automation: What It Is and Why It Matters

Marketing automation is not magic, but it can feel like it when implemented correctly. At its core, marketing automation involves using software to automate repetitive marketing tasks. This includes email marketing, social media posting, and even ad campaigns. The beauty of marketing automation is that it allows you to provide personalized experiences to your customers, ensuring they feel valued and understood.

Why does this matter for your business?

  • Efficiency: ๐Ÿค– Automated systems handle the mundane tasks, freeing up your time to focus on strategic activities.
  • Consistency: ๐ŸŽฏ Automated processes ensure that every customer receives a consistent experience, which builds trust and loyalty.
  • Personalization: ๐ŸŒŸ Tailor your messages and offers to individual customer preferences, increasing engagement and conversions.

What Exactly Can You Automate?

There are several components within your marketing strategy that can benefit from automation. Let's break them down:

  1. Email Campaigns: Segment your audience and send targeted emails based on their behavior and preferences.
  2. Social Media: Schedule posts in advance and use analytics to optimize your content strategy.
  3. Lead Scoring: Identify your most engaged prospects and prioritize them for follow-up.
  4. Customer Relationship Management (CRM): Keep track of customer interactions and automate follow-up tasks.

Understanding the Customer Journey

The customer journey isn't a straight path. It's a series of interactions your customers have with your brand, both online and offline. It's crucial to identify and map these interactions to provide a personalized experience.

Here's a simplified version of a typical customer journey:

  • Awareness: โœจ The customer becomes aware of your brand through ads, social media, or word-of-mouth.
  • Consideration: ๐Ÿค” They research and compare your offerings with competitors.
  • Decision: ๐Ÿ’ผ The customer makes a purchase decision.
  • Retention: ๐Ÿ”„ Post-purchase follow-up and customer support ensure loyalty.

Automating the Touchpoints

Each stage of the customer journey offers opportunities for automation. Letโ€™s explore how to maximize the impact:

  1. Awareness Stage:

    • Automated Ads: ๐Ÿช Use retargeting ads to keep your brand top of mind.
    • Social Media: ๐Ÿ“… Schedule posts to maintain a consistent online presence.
    • Content Distribution: ๐Ÿ“ง Automate the distribution of blog posts and newsletters.
  2. Consideration Stage:

    • Email Drip Campaigns: ๐Ÿ“ฌ Send targeted emails based on customer behavior and preferences.
    • Lead Scoring: ๐Ÿ”ข Prioritize warm leads using automated scoring systems.
    • Personalized Recommendations: ๐Ÿ›๏ธ Use AI to recommend products or services based on previous interactions.
  3. Decision Stage:

  • Abandoned Cart Emails: ๐Ÿ›’ Automate follow-ups to encourage customers to complete their purchase.
  • Special Offers: ๐ŸŽ Send automated discount codes or special offers to close the sale.
  1. Retention Stage:
    • Post-Purchase Follow-up: ๐Ÿ“ฒ Automate thank-you emails and request for reviews.
    • Loyalty Programs: โค๏ธ Use automated systems to manage and reward loyal customers.
    • Customer Support: ๐Ÿ“ž Implement chatbots to provide instant assistance.

Choosing the Right Marketing Automation Tools

Not every tool will fit every business. Itโ€™s essential to select the platforms that align with your company's unique needs and objectives. Hereโ€™s a rundown of some top-rated tools that can help you get started:

  1. HubSpot: ๐Ÿ› ๏ธ A comprehensive tool offering a suite of services, including email marketing, social media management, and lead nurturing. It's perfect for businesses looking for an all-in-one solution.
  2. Mailchimp: ๐Ÿต Known primarily for its email marketing, Mailchimp has evolved to include basic CRM functionalities, social media scheduling, and automation workflows.
  3. Marketo: ๐ŸŒ A robust tool ideal for enterprise-level businesses needing extensive customization and advanced analytics.
  4. ActiveCampaign: ๐Ÿ“ง This platform excels at email marketing automation and includes CRM and sales automation capabilities.
  5. Zapier: ๐ŸŒŸ While not a marketing automation tool per se, Zapier can connect different platforms to automate workflows seamlessly. Itโ€™s a must-have tool for integrating various services.

Key Features to Look For

When choosing your tools, keep an eye out for these critical features:

  • Ease of Use: ๐Ÿ‘Œ The tool should have an intuitive interface and robust customer support.
  • Customizability: ๐Ÿ› ๏ธ You need to tailor the tool to your specific needs.
  • Integrations: ๐Ÿ”— Ensure it integrates seamlessly with your existing software and platforms.
  • Analytics: ๐Ÿ“Š Good tools should offer solid metrics to track performance and ROI.

Key Performance Indicators (KPIs) to Monitor

Focusing on the right metrics allows you to gauge the effectiveness of your marketing automation and make data-driven decisions. Here are some essential KPIs to keep an eye on:

  • Conversion Rate: ๐Ÿ“ˆ The percentage of visitors who take a desired action, such as signing up for a newsletter or making a purchase.
  • Click-Through Rate (CTR): ๐Ÿ–ฑ๏ธ The ratio of users who click on a specific link to the number of total users who view a page, email, or ad.
  • Customer Lifetime Value (CLV): ๐Ÿ† The total revenue you can expect from a single customer account.
  • Email Open Rate: ๐Ÿ“ง The percentage of recipients who open your automated emails.
  • Lead Conversion Rate: ๐Ÿ‘ฅ The percentage of leads who convert into paying customers.

Analyzing Customer Behavior

Understanding how customers interact with your content and offerings is pivotal for refining your strategies. Use these techniques to get a comprehensive view of customer behavior:

  1. Heatmaps: ๐Ÿ”ฅ Tools like Hotjar or Crazy Egg help visualize where users are clicking, scrolling, and spending the most time on your website.
  2. Customer Feedback: ๐Ÿ—จ๏ธ Survey tools like SurveyMonkey or Typeform can provide direct insights into customer preferences and pain points.
  3. A/B Testing: ๐Ÿงช Run parallel tests to determine which version of your content or landing page performs better.

Using Analytics Platforms

Analytics platforms are indispensable for tracking the performance of your marketing automation efforts. Here are some top platforms that can provide valuable insights:

  • Google Analytics: ๐ŸŒ Track website traffic, user behavior, and conversions. Use the Goals feature to monitor specific actions you want users to take.
  • HubSpot Analytics: ๐Ÿ“Š Integrated with HubSpotโ€™s CRM, this tool offers detailed insights into the performance of your email campaigns, social media efforts, and lead generation activities.
  • Mixpanel: ๐ŸŽ›๏ธ Particularly useful for SaaS businesses, Mixpanel tracks user interactions in real-time, providing actionable data for improving user experience.
  • Salesforce Analytics: ๐Ÿ’ผ If youโ€™re using Salesforce for CRM, its analytics tools offer comprehensive reports on customer interactions and sales performance.
